Greene County Expo Center Camping Introduce

For local residents of Greene County and surrounding areas who are attending events at the Greene County Expo Center and require convenient on-site camping, or for those seeking a straightforward, potentially short-term camping option near Xenia, the Greene County Expo Center Camping, located at 120 Fairground Rd, Xenia, OH 45385, USA, offers a practical solution. When your search for "camping near me" is driven by event attendance or the need for a simple overnight stay in the Xenia vicinity, this camping facility associated with the Expo Center provides a unique context for your camping experience. It's important to understand that camping at an expo center might differ significantly from traditional campgrounds located in natural settings, often prioritizing accessibility to event venues and basic amenities for short-term stays.

The environment at Greene County Expo Center Camping is primarily dictated by its location within the grounds of the Greene County Expo Center. Unlike campgrounds nestled in woods or by lakes, the environment here is likely more utilitarian and focused on functionality. Campers can expect to be situated on relatively open grounds, possibly on grass or gravel lots, within the vicinity of the expo buildings, arenas, and other facilities of the center. Shade might be limited depending on the layout and any existing trees on the property. The atmosphere will likely be influenced by the events taking place at the Expo Center, which could range from agricultural fairs and trade shows to concerts and sporting events. While it might not offer the natural serenity of a state park, the environment provides unparalleled convenience for event attendees, allowing for easy access to and from the event venues. For local users attending events, this proximity can be a significant advantage, eliminating the need for off-site accommodation and transportation.
